Critical Voices: Limitations and Practical Realities

No system is flawless, and skeptics rightly point out several constraints:

  • Coverage variability: Not all activities—from scuba diving to extreme sports—are automatically included unless explicitly endorsed during policy enrollment.
  • Geopolitical bias: Algorithmic models can underweight rare but catastrophic events if historical data lacks precedent, leading to insufficient reserves during black swan scenarios.
  • Digital exclusion: Travelers lacking smartphone access miss out on instant notifications unless providers maintain SMS fallback channels.

Moreover, while automation improves speed, it introduces new dependency risks. Over-reliance on APIs makes coverage susceptible to service outages at provider endpoints—a vulnerability that has already surfaced during recent cloud provider incidents affecting multiple carriers simultaneously.
